Mar 19, 2025 · Atom, smallest unit into which matter can be divided without the release of electrically charged particles. It also is the smallest unit of matter that has the characteristic properties of a chemical element. As such, the atom is the basic building block of chemistry.

Mar 10, 2025 · atomic radius, half the distance between the nuclei of identical neighbouring atoms in the solid form of an element. An atom has no rigid spherical boundary, but it may be thought of as a tiny, dense positive nucleus surrounded by a diffuse negative cloud of electrons.

Feb 14, 2025 · The distance across an atomic nucleus of average size is roughly 10 −14 metre—only 1/10,000 the diameter of the atom. Mar 19, 2025 · As Bohr had noticed, the radius of the n = 1 orbit is approximately the same size as an atom. With his model, Bohr explained how electrons could jump from one orbit to another only by emitting or absorbing energy in fixed quanta.

Mar 19, 2025 · Bohr atom The electron travels in circular orbits around the nucleus. The orbits have quantized sizes and energies. Energy is emitted from the atom when the electron jumps from one orbit to another closer to the nucleus.

The angstrom is also used to measure such quantities as atomic and molecular sizes (most elements have atoms with radii of about 1 to 2 Å) and the thickness of films on liquids.
